Chapter One: Introduction

1.1 Background of the Study

Electoral observation is an essential aspect of ensuring transparency and fairness in the electoral process. In Nigeria, civil society organizations (CSOs) and international observers play a crucial role in monitoring elections, identifying irregularities, and promoting transparency. In Lafia LGA, Nasarawa State, the presence of electoral observers during elections has been linked to greater transparency in the electoral process. This study will explore the impact of electoral observation on the transparency of elections in Lafia LGA, focusing on how observer groups contribute to credible and free elections.

1.2 Statement of the Problem

Electoral malpractices, such as rigging, voter suppression, and fraud, remain prevalent in many parts of Nigeria, undermining the credibility of elections. The role of electoral observers in addressing these issues is critical, but the impact of their presence in Lafia LGA has not been fully explored. This study seeks to examine the relationship between electoral observation and electoral transparency in Lafia.

1.8 Operational Definition of Terms

  1. Electoral Observation: The act of monitoring and assessing the conduct of elections by third-party groups to ensure fairness and transparency.
  2. Electoral Transparency: The openness and accountability of the electoral process, ensuring that elections are free, fair, and credible.
  3. Voter Confidence: The trust and belief that voters have in the fairness and legitimacy of the electoral process.
